单词 disappropriation
释义

disappropriationn.

Brit. /ˌdɪsəprəʊprɪˈeɪʃn/, U.S. /ˌdɪsəˌproʊpriˈeɪʃ(ə)n/
Forms: see disappropriate v. and -ion suffix1.
Origin: Formed within English, by derivation. Etymons: disappropriate v., -ion suffix1.
Etymology: < disappropriate v. + -ion suffix1.Compare post-classical Latin disappropriatio (from 14th cent. in British sources).
The action of removing something from the possession or ownership of a person, organization, nation, etc.; (in earlier use) spec. the removal of a tithe or benefice from a religious body to which it had been officially attached.

1555 Anno Secundo & Tertio Philippi & Mariae (new ed.) iv. f. xviiv The sayd person & persons..shalbe patrones of the sayd personage so disapropriated in lyke estate degre and condition as they were of the patronage of the vicarege before ye sayd disapropriation.
1618 J. Selden Hist. Tithes vi. 94 Neither did any such thing follow vpon such Presentation as Disappropriation, in regard of the Endowments or Temporalties.
1698 tr. F. de S. de la Mothe-Fénelon Maxims of Saints xvi. 73 When it is clearly understood, what Mystical Men mean by Property, 'tis no hard matter to understand what is meant by Disappropriation [Fr. desapropriation], 'tis the Operation of Grace.
1738 E. Chambers Cycl. (ed. 2) (at cited word) Appropriation, To dissolve an appropriation, it is enough to present a clerk to the bishop, and he to institute and induct him: for that once done, the benefice returns to its former nature. This is called disappropriation.
1869 R. F. Burton Explor. Highlands Brazil I. 42 It is not easy to suggest a measure without the evils of ‘disappropriation’.
1885 Folk-lore Jrnl. 3 45 A ruthless crusade against the clergy and landed gentry; the proposed result..being their entire disappropriation for the behoof of a new order of proprietors, the yeomen.
1964 Listener 19 Nov. 797/2 This demands an act of disappropriation, a disowning of the self,..and the substitution of the passive, perfectly detached will centred on God.
1993 Xenia (Ohio) Daily Gaz. 6 Dec. 11/4 The balance of funds appropriated for this purpose will not be expended and disappropriation of the funds is advisable.
2009 R. Gasché Europe vii. 212 To participate in..European humanism..implies overcoming the particularity of national cultures, which become meaningful only within the horizon of their disappropriation.
